Property sales in Southsea, Hampshire
Based on sales in the past year, the average property price in Southsea, Hampshire is £290,380 which is £9,219 higher than the UK average of £281,161. Last year in 2022 property prices in Southsea increased 5.1% from 2021.
Total property sales have increased with 1206 sales in 2022 compared to 487 in 2021, a difference of +719.
📈 Price history
In Southsea, Hampshire the most expensive property type is Detached with an average price of £704,857. This is followed by Semi-Detached and Terraced properties which have average prices of £564,052 and £305,937 respectively. Flat is the cheapeast type of property you can buy with an average price of £212,039
